Understanding Volatile Slot Machines: Definition and Mechanics
Volatile slot machines are characterized by their high variance, meaning they tend to pay out larger jackpots infrequently, rather than smaller, more regular wins. This volatility influences gameplay experience, with the potential for significant payouts over a longer sequence of spins, but also a greater risk of extended losing streaks.
| Feature | Low Volatility | High Volatility |
|---|---|---|
| Bet Frequency | High (smaller wins often) | Low (larger wins infrequently) |
| Payout Size | Smaller, consistent | Significantly larger, less frequent |
| Player Experience | Steady, predictable | Thrilling, unpredictable |
| Typical Audience | Casual players | High rollers, thrill-seekers |

The Mathematical Backbone of Volatility: RNG and Return to Player
At the core of these machines are RNGs that assign probabilities to each reel outcome, calibrated to achieve desired payout percentages often ranging from 85% to 98%. Variance, a statistical measure of payout dispersion, reflects the level of risk associated with a particular game:
- High variance : Greater risk, larger possible wins, suited for thrill seekers.
- Low variance : Smaller wins, more consistent, better for cautious players.
Operators leverage these mathematical foundations to attract specific player segments but must manage their own risk exposure carefully, especially with the unpredictable nature of volatile machines.
Risk Management and Regulatory Considerations
High volatility slots pose notable challenges for casino operators. In periods of low player engagement, these machines can impact overall revenue streams due to their infrequent payouts. Conversely, they can create substantial jackpots that significantly boost player retention when triggered. Regulatory bodies also scrutinize these machines to prevent misleading practices, emphasizing transparency in payout percentages and betting limits.
The Cultural and Psychological Impact
Volatile slot machines tap into the human psyche’s thrill-seeking tendencies. The possibility of hitting a massive payout after an extended dry spell can trigger adrenaline surges and emotional highs, reinforcing continued play despite the inherent risk of frustration. Such features are exploited in marketing campaigns but raise ethical questions about responsible gambling.
